Greenhouse gas emissions in EU-15 slip

Tue May 8, 2:54 PM ET

BRUSSELS (AFP) - Greenhouse gas emissions from the 15 most
developed EU members eased only slightly in 2005, according
to EU figures on Tuesday, suggesting a lot of work remained
to be done to meet Kyoto Protocol commitments.

The European Environment Agency said that climate-changing
greenhouse gases from the 15 countries fell only 0.8 percent
in 2005 from 2004, mainly due to lower use of fossil fuels and
carbon in particular.

"The drop in emissions, while positive, must be viewed in
context," said EEA executive director Jacqueline McGlade.
"It represents a decrease over only one year and may not be
representative of the trend over a longer period."

The reduction in greenhouse gas emissions in 2005 brought
the decrease to the Kyoto Protocol's reference year of 1990
to 1.9 percent.
